Resume Writing Tips

  • β†’Highlight any specific software proficiency relevant to plasma modeling, such as COMSOL or Fluent.
  • β†’Include measurable outcomes from research projects to demonstrate the impact of your work on energy solutions.
  • β†’Showcase publications in peer-reviewed journals to underline your contributions to the field.
  • β†’Tailor your resume to emphasize interdisciplinary collaborations, detailing the roles played in these efforts.
  • β†’Mention any experience with grant proposals or funding applications to showcase your ability to secure research funding.

Common Mistakes to Avoid

  • βœ•Using generic physics terminology rather than specific plasma physics terms can dilute your expertise.
  • βœ•Not emphasizing collaboration experiences can overlook your interdisciplinary teamwork skills.
  • βœ•Forgetting to quantify achievements in previous roles can make your impact less clear to employers.
  • βœ•Neglecting to mention specific advanced diagnostic instruments used could lead to missed opportunities to showcase technical skills.

Plasma Physicist Career Path

Career Progression

Entry-Level Plasma Physicist

Conducts initial experiments and simulations under supervision, focusing on plasma diagnostics and data analysis.

Mid-Level Plasma Physicist

Leads research projects involving plasma behavior, collaborating with interdisciplinary teams to improve energy efficiency in fusion reactors.

Senior Plasma Physicist

Oversees advanced research initiatives, focusing on applications of plasma physics in national laboratories and private sector energy companies.

Research Director

Manages large-scale research programs, guiding teams in the investigation of plasma technologies for medical and space applications.

Consulting Expert

Provides expertise to government and private organizations on implementing plasma technologies in various industrial settings.

Plasma Physicist Interview Questions

What techniques do you use for plasma diagnostics? +

Describe specific methods such as laser-induced fluorescence or Thomson scattering.

How do you approach computational modeling in your research? +

Provide examples of software or frameworks like MATLAB or COMSOL you have used.

Can you explain how electromagnetic fields influence plasma behavior? +

Discuss the relationship between fields and particle motion with specific examples.

What projects have you worked on that directly utilized fusion energy applications? +

Detail any hands-on work with tokamak or stellarator systems.

How do you collaborate with engineers on plasma containment methods? +

Mention your role in applying theoretical knowledge in practical settings.

What safety protocols are essential when conducting experiments involving plasma? +

Highlight your understanding of lab safety in high-energy environments.

About the Plasma Physicist Role

The intricacies of plasma dynamics are explored by Plasma Physicists, who engage in high-stakes research to push the boundaries of energy production and propulsion systems. Utilizing advanced simulation software and diagnostic tools, they analyze the behavior of charged particles in experimental setups, contributing vital research towards sustainable energy solutions like nuclear fusion. Collaboration with multidisciplinary teams enables them to convert theoretical concepts into real-world applications, often aligning with projects at national laboratories or cutting-edge private research facilities.

Frequently Asked Questions

What educational background is required to become a Plasma Physicist? +

Typically, a PhD in Physics or a related scientific field is required, focusing on plasma physics or a similar specialization.

How does research in plasma physics impact everyday technology? +

Research often informs advancements in energy production, medical technologies, and materials science, affecting a wide range of applications.

What are the leading organizations hiring Plasma Physicists? +

Major employers include national laboratories, universities, and private companies focused on energy innovations.

Are there opportunities for cross-disciplinary work in plasma physics? +

Yes, many Plasma Physicists collaborate with engineers, chemists, and medical researchers to apply their findings broadly.

What is the future outlook for careers in plasma physics? +

Given the increasing focus on sustainable energy and advanced technologies, demand for Plasma Physicists is expected to grow.

What are some common research focus areas for Plasma Physicists? +

Areas include nuclear fusion, plasma wave phenomena, and interactions of plasma with materials.
